Set of eight Brownfield plates:
Set of eight Brownfield plates: each with raised hand painted decoration, fruit and flowers, all on celadon ground with gilt borders, impressed Brownfield mark, 9-3/8 in.; with matching compote, 2 x 9 in., (nine pieces). Excellent condition, very minor surface abrasions, scratches, three plates with minor chip to foot ring, losses to gilt highlights. Private Collection, Marietta, Georgia

Delft peacock plate, standing
Delft peacock plate, standing yellow and blue peacock between sponged manganese trees, birds in sky, from Bristol barnyard series, circa 1735, 8-3/4 in. Rim chips and glaze losses, scattered retouch to feathers. Mark and Marjorie Allen, Putnam Valley, New York, 1990

BRISTOL DELFT POLYCHROME PLATE
BRISTOL DELFT POLYCHROME PLATE Circa 1770-1780; the yellow sun face with blue rays within iron red demilune-banded cavetto and manganese interlocked chain border. 8 7/8 in. diam. Provenance: Jonathan Horne.
